| Aspect | Remote Prototyping Engineer | Remote Product Designer |
|---|
| Primary Focus | Developing and testing prototypes to validate technical feasibility | Designing user interfaces and experiences for products |
| Skills & Credentials | Engineering background, prototyping tools, technical knowledge | Design skills, UX/UI tools, creativity |
| Work Environment | Collaborates with engineers and developers | Works closely with users, product managers, and developers |
| Industry Usage | Tech, hardware, software development | Tech, consumer apps, digital products |
While both roles involve creating prototypes, the Remote Prototyping Engineer focuses on technical feasibility and engineering prototypes, whereas the Remote Product Designer emphasizes user experience and visual design.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right role based on your skills and career goals.
